云服务器大型游戏,大型网络游戏云服务器配置指南,构建稳定高效的在线体验
- 综合资讯
- 2025-03-14 12:47:08
- 2

本指南旨在为大型游戏开发者提供详细的云服务器配置建议,以确保其游戏能够提供稳定且高效的用户体验,我们将深入探讨选择合适的云服务提供商、优化硬件资源分配、实施有效的网络策...
本指南旨在为大型游戏开发者提供详细的云服务器配置建议,以确保其游戏能够提供稳定且高效的用户体验,我们将深入探讨选择合适的云服务提供商、优化硬件资源分配、实施有效的网络策略以及监控和调整系统性能等关键步骤,通过遵循这些指导原则,开发人员可以确保他们的游戏在云端平台上运行顺畅,满足高并发用户的流畅体验需求。
随着互联网技术的飞速发展,网络游戏已成为全球范围内最受欢迎的游戏类型之一,为了满足日益增长的玩家需求,许多开发者选择采用云服务器来托管他们的游戏服务器,本文将详细介绍如何为大型网络游戏设计合适的云服务器配置,以确保游戏的流畅运行和高性能表现。
了解大型网络游戏的特性与挑战
- 高并发性:大型网络游戏通常拥有数百万甚至上千万的用户同时在线,这要求服务器具备强大的处理能力和负载均衡能力。
- 实时交互:玩家的操作需要迅速响应,否则会导致卡顿或延迟现象,影响用户体验。
- 数据一致性:多台服务器之间需要进行数据的同步和备份,以防止数据丢失和数据不一致的情况发生。
- 安全性:保护用户的个人信息和游戏资产不受黑客攻击是至关重要的。
- 可扩展性:随着用户数量的增加,服务器的资源也需要相应地进行扩容以满足需求。
选择合适的云服务商
在选择云服务商时,我们需要考虑以下几个方面:
图片来源于网络,如有侵权联系删除
- 可靠性:云服务商应具备高可用性和低故障率,确保游戏服务的连续性和稳定性。
- 性能:高性能的计算资源和网络带宽对于提升游戏性能至关重要。
- 成本效益:在预算有限的情况下,寻找性价比高的解决方案非常重要。
- 技术支持:专业的技术团队能够快速解决问题,保障游戏的正常运行。
确定云服务器的基本参数
1 CPU核心数
CPU核心数决定了服务器的计算能力,每台服务器至少应该配备8-16个核心,对于大型网络游戏来说,更多的核心可以更好地处理复杂的游戏逻辑和多线程任务。
2 内存大小
内存大小直接影响着游戏的加载速度和运行的流畅度,建议至少配备32GB以上的内存,以便于存储大量的数据和缓存信息。
3 硬盘空间
硬盘空间主要用于存放游戏文件、数据库和其他相关数据,根据游戏的大小和玩家的数量来确定所需的硬盘空间,SSD(固态硬盘)比HDD(机械硬盘)更快,但价格更高,可以根据实际情况进行选择。
4 网络带宽
网络带宽决定了服务器与客户端之间的通信速度,对于大型网络游戏而言,至少需要100Mbps以上的上行带宽才能满足需求,还需要考虑到未来可能出现的峰值流量情况,预留一定的冗余容量。
优化游戏服务器环境
1 安装必要的软件包
安装必要的操作系统、游戏引擎和相关工具链等软件包,Linux系统上的Ubuntu或者CentOS都是不错的选择,还要确保安装了最新的安全补丁和驱动程序。
2 配置防火墙规则
合理设置防火墙规则,只允许必要的端口和服务访问外部网络,从而提高系统的安全性。
3 调整系统参数
通过调整系统的进程亲和力、虚拟内存管理等参数来进一步提升性能。
图片来源于网络,如有侵权联系删除
4 使用负载均衡器
当单台服务器无法承受大量请求时,可以使用负载均衡器将请求分发到多个后端服务器上,实现负载均衡的效果。
监控和管理服务器
1 实施监控系统
部署监控系统以实时监测服务器的健康状况,包括CPU使用率、内存占用率、磁盘I/O等关键指标,一旦发现异常情况,及时采取措施进行处理。
2 定期备份重要数据
定期备份数据库和其他重要文件,以防数据丢失导致的服务中断。
3 更新和维护系统
定期更新系统和应用程序的安全补丁,修复已知的漏洞,同时也要注意维护硬件设备的正常运行状态,避免因设备老化而引发问题。
为大型网络游戏选择合适的云服务器并进行合理的配置是非常重要的,只有综合考虑各种因素,才能打造出既高效又稳定的游戏服务平台,为玩家带来更好的游戏体验。
本文链接:https://www.zhitaoyun.cn/1794179.html
发表评论